With Ultra Rares in particular, entering a single value for the item on our site doesn't always do the item justice.
Really scarce and/or seldomly traded Ultra Rares (as often is the case) can experience quite major swings in price from sale-to-sale,
and hence it's important to learn more about the Ultra Rare in question before deciding to either sell or purchase that item!

To help you get a better insight into the Ultra Rare in question, we will now provide additional information about Ultra Rares;
Such as the Volatility, Margin & Trade Volume of the item.

There's a maximum of 3 attributes that can be shown on an item:
Volatility
Measurement for the degree of variation in sales-price.
A High volatility means that the item in question has been observed to sell for rather drastically different prices.
While a Low volatility means that sales prices haven't deviated very far from each other.
Margin
The Difference between the highest and lowest expected sales-price.
A High margin means that there's a larger expected range at which an item can be bought and sold.
A larger price-range at which an item is commonly sold implies that it's less feasible to provide a single accurate price, you should take more caution in this case.
Trade Volume
Indicates how frequently an item gets traded.
A High trade volume means more points of reference when setting the price, resulting in a generally more accurate price (compared to low/no trade volume).
A Low trade volume on the other hand results in less points of reference and more of an uncertain price.
